Splatoon 2: Crucial push and stop in Rainmaker [13(5)-3, Grim Range Blaster]
It's sensible to hide from the Rainmaker's shield inksploding, if only I could lead the inkling with the Rainmaker a bit more. But never mind, the Rainmaker doesn't go far, and after mistaking a squidmate for a green inkling, I get a glancing blow on an actual opponent, and spot them diving off the bridge to come at me again. Not on my watch, mister. That charges some Tenta Missiles, and I press forwards as the green team deals with them, but not getting far. The Rainmaker is reset and grabbed by the green team, who go backwards with it this time, not that we take advantage of that, but we finally get the Rainmaker moving after it's dropped once more.
I lurk around the edges as our squidmate makes a nifty dash down the blind corridor, giving us a good lead, and I push up with a squidmate to apply pressure on both sides. The Rainmaker is dropped, though, and with lots of green ink around it. The Dualies dodge-roll their way out of my blasts, and the Dynamo Roller reappears behind me, so I decide it's best to duck out of there. My retreat puts me in a good position to intercept the Rainmaker, probably heading to our blind corridor, which is good, but I want to make sure our flank is safe before lurking in the lower turf.
Taking a look around lets the green team nab the Rainmaker again, but they don't get far, and our defensive method of splatting first and moving the Rainmaker second works well again. Even so, we could do better than just running away from any support, but this is to be expected outside of League battles. We hold the Rainmaker's position nicely too, and the green team find themselves all splatted, although the downside to that is them all returning at about the same time. It's quite a barrier to get through.
The Rainmaker stays where it is for a bit longer, but with Tenta Missiles flying out at a the long green inkling and the Rainmaker, I dash forwards and grab the Rainmaker to see how far I can get. Quite far, in fact, and in sight of the podium. I could have waited for support, but am hoping that the few extra steps I took will give us an advantage.
The green team grab the Rainmaker and push back. I try to hold the turf on the bridge and prevent support from reaching the Rainmaker, but all I get are glancing blows. Not even my Tenta Missiles do much except spur the Rainmaker on. Thankfully, a squidmate catches up to the Rainmaker just before the green team steals the lead. That extra step I took could prove vital after all, particularly with less than twenty seconds left in the battle. A squidmate grabs the Rainmaker and holds it as the clock ticks down, securing victory in a battle decided by two lunges. Woomy!
